The future of Bitcoin is a fascinating and widely debated topic. While no one can predict with certainty where Bitcoin is heading, here are some possibilities based on current trends and expert opinions:

---

1. Mainstream Adoption

Global Currency: Bitcoin could become a widely accepted form of payment as more businesses, governments, and individuals adopt it.

Store of Value (Digital Gold): Many see Bitcoin becoming a primary asset for preserving wealth, similar to gold but in a digital form.

---

2. Institutional Integration

Large financial institutions are increasingly investing in Bitcoin and offering Bitcoin-related products (e.g., ETFs, futures). This could drive more adoption and stabilize its price over time.

---

3. Government Regulation

Positive Scenario: Governments might embrace Bitcoin, creating clear regulations that encourage adoption while mitigating risks like fraud and money laundering.

Negative Scenario: Some governments may attempt to ban or heavily restrict Bitcoin due to competition with central bank digital currencies (CBDCs).

---

4. Technological Evolution

Scaling Solutions: Technologies like the Lightning Network could make Bitcoin transactions faster and cheaper, boosting its usability as a currency.

Energy Efficiency: Innovations in mining or shifts to renewable energy could address concerns about Bitcoin's environmental impact.

---

5. Potential Risks

Competition: Bitcoin faces competition from other cryptocurrencies with advanced features (e.g., Ethereum, Solana).

Loss of Interest: If people lose trust in Bitcoin due to extreme volatility or regulatory crackdowns, its value could decline.

---

6. Global Reserve Asset

In the long term, Bitcoin might become a global reserve asset, held by countries as a hedge against inflation and economic instability.

---

7. Decentralized Finance (DeFi) Integration

Bitcoin could play a bigger role in decentralized finance, becoming a cornerstone for lending, borrowing, and other financial services without intermediaries.
